Embassy of Russia, Washington, D.C. | |
---|---|
Location | Washington, DC, United States |
Address | 2650 Wisconsin Avenue, N.W. |
Coordinates | 38°55′28.48″N 77°4′29.3″W / 38.9245778°N 77.074806°W |
Ambassador | Anatoly Antonov |
Website | washington.mid.ru |
The Embassy of Russia in Washington, D.C. (Russian: Посольство России в США) is the diplomatic mission of the Russian Federation to the United States. The chancery is located at 2650 Wisconsin Avenue, Northwest, Washington, D.C.[1][2] The embassy oversees consulates in New York and Houston.[3]